International Day of Forests

In news

The United Nations observes March 21 as the International Day of Forests, commemorating the green cover around the world and reiterating its importance.

Theme

“Forest restoration: a path to recovery and well-being”.

Highlights
  • The United Nations General Assembly proclaimed March 21 as the International Day of Forests (IDF) in 2012.
  • The Day celebrates and raises awareness of the importance of all types of forests. 
  • On this day, countries are encouraged to undertake local, national and international efforts to organize activities involving forests and trees, such as tree-planting campaigns.
Forest cover in India
  • Since Independence, a fifth of India’s land has consistently been under forests, despite the population increasing more than three times.
  • As per the biennial State of Forest Report, 2019, India’s forest cover has increased by 3,976 sq km or 0.56% since 2017.
  • For the second consecutive time since 2007, the report recorded a gain — an impressive 1,275 sq km — in dense forest (including very dense forest with a canopy density of over 70%, and moderately dense forest with a canopy density of 40-70%).
